Programme Description

The Foundation in Arts (Building Environment) programme provides students with a comprehensive understanding of the fundamental principles and techniques involved in the built environment field. This programme offers a formal and structured curriculum that equips students with the necessary skills and knowledge to pursue a successful career in areas such as architecture, urban planning, and construction management. Through a range of academic subjects, practical exercises, and real-world projects, students develop a thorough understanding of design principles, sustainable development, building regulations, and project management.

Programme Highlights

  • Mode: Full Time
  • Duration: 12 months
  • Credit Hours: 50
  • Scholarships Available
  • Intake: Jan/Feb, May/June, Sept/Oct
  • Course in Petaling Jaya

Entry
Requirements

  • Passed SPM/SPMV with 5 credits including Mathematics OR
  • Other qualifications recognized as equivalent by the Government of Malaysia
